What is Sulfuric Acid? (Sulfuric Acid H₂SO₄)

Sulfuric acid (sulfuric acid) is a strong inorganic acid, with the chemical formula H₂SO₄.
Under normal conditions, sulfuric acid is a colorless to pale yellow, odorless, flammable liquid. highly corrosive , and high moisture absorption capacity.

In industry, when it comes to What is H₂SO₄, it is often considered a foundation chemical.
A country's annual sulfuric acid consumption is often used as an “indirect indicator” of its level of industrial development.

  • Some outstanding features of sulfuric acid:
    • Strong acid, reacts violently with water and many organic and inorganic compounds.
    • Easily soluble in waterThe dissolution process generates a lot of heat and requires proper technique.
    • Usually produced according to contact process (Contact Process) from sulfur or SO₂ gas sources from industrial emissions.

Can say, sulfuric acid is one of the most important basic chemicals, accounting for a large proportion of the total amount of chemicals used globally.

Basic Properties of Sulfuric Acid (H₂SO₄)

To understand better What is sulfuric acid?, you need to grasp some typical properties of H₂SO₄ in actual operation.

  • Form of existence: Viscous liquid, heavier than water, infinitely soluble in water.
  • Strong acidity: H₂SO₄ dissociates strongly to give H⁺, reacts with metals, bases, basic oxides and salts.
  • Hydration: Strong hygroscopicity, can separate water from organic substances (such as sugar, paper, wood...).
  • Oxidizing properties: Hot concentrated sulfuric acid is a strong oxidizing agent, reacting with many metals and non-metals.

It is these properties that make H₂SO₄ both an extremely useful tool in production and a dangerous chemical if not managed and used properly according to safety procedures.

Top 10 Applications of Sulfuric Acid (Sulfuric Acid H₂SO₄) in Today's Life

1. Sulfuric Acid in Fertilizer Production

One of the most important answers to the question “What is sulfuric acid used for?” is: fertilizer production.
It is the largest consumer of sulfuric acid in the world.

Sulfuric acid (H₂SO₄) is a core ingredient in the production of phosphate and compound fertilizers:

  • Superphosphate: Produced by treating phosphate rock with H₂SO₄ to create calcium dihydrophosphate – a form of phosphorus that is easily absorbed by plants.
  • Ammonium sulfate: A by-product of many chemical processes, it provides both nitrogen and sulfur.
  • NPK fertilizer: Sulfuric acid plays an important role in the technology chain of phosphorus regulation and transformation for NPK fertilizer.

2. Sulfuric Acid in Metal Processing

In the metallurgical industry, sulfuric acid H₂SO₄ is an important chemical for metal surface treatment.

  • Metal cleaning: Remove rust, oxides and impurities before rolling, drawing, plating or painting.
  • Electroplating (plating): Clean and activate steel, copper, aluminum… surfaces before zinc, nickel or copper plating.
  • Lead-acid battery production: H₂SO₄ solution is an important electrolyte in batteries.

3. Sulfuric Acid in Wastewater Treatment

Another popular application when it comes to What is H₂SO₄ is industrial water and wastewater treatment.
Sulfuric acid helps:

  • Adjust pH: Neutralizes highly alkaline wastewater, protects pipeline systems and optimizes the performance of coagulation processes.
  • Heavy metal removal: H₂SO₄ participates in pH adjustment to precipitate toxic metal ions (Pb²⁺, Zn²⁺…).
  • Support physical-chemical and biological processes: Helps the water environment reach the optimal pH range for microbial treatment.

4. Sulfuric Acid in Chemical Production

As base chemicals, sulfuric acid is used to produce many other basic chemicals:

  • Nitric acid (HNO₃): H₂SO₄ participates in the production process of HNO₃ – an important raw material for fertilizers and industrial explosives.
  • Phosphoric acid (H₃PO₄): Used in the production of fertilizers and food additives.
  • Sulfate salts: Such as sodium sulfate, ammonium sulfate… used in detergents, dyes, paper.

5. Applications in Battery and Accumulator Production

  • Lead-acid batteries: Sulfuric acid solution is the main electrolyte, participating in the reaction to generate and store electrical energy.
  • Energy storage system: Some renewable energy storage solutions still use H₂SO₄ in special battery structures.

6. Applications in Electronics Manufacturing

In the electronics industry, sulfuric acid is used as a cleaning and surface treatment chemical:

  • Cleaning the printed circuit board: Remove dirt, grease, oxide on PCB surface before plating or mounting components.
  • Battery cell processing: Support for improved performance and stability for some battery types.

7. Sulfuric Acid in Industrial Cleaners

Due to its strong acidity, sulfuric acid H₂SO₄ is an important ingredient in some industrial cleaning products:

  • Cleaning toilets and metal surfaces: Removes limescale, rust, and long-standing scale.
  • Cleaning industrial equipment: Remove limestone deposits in boilers and cooling towers if applied properly.

8. Sulfuric Acid in Petroleum Processing

In the refining and petrochemical industry, sulfuric acid is used to:

  • Impurities separation: Removes unsaturated hydrocarbons and some unwanted impurities.
  • Improve product quality: Helps improve octane index, stability of gasoline, diesel, lubricants.

9. Raw Materials for Synthesizing Other Acids

H₂SO₄ is the starting material in many important inorganic acid synthesis reactions:

  • Nitric acid: Used for fertilizers, oxidizers and industrial explosives.
  • Phosphoric acid: Used in fertilizers, food and pharmaceutical industries.

10. Role in Energy Production

In the energy sector, sulfuric acid appears in:

  • Energy storage battery system: Used in solar and wind energy solutions to help stabilize power sources.
  • Liquid battery technology: Some special battery lines use H₂SO₄ solution to increase ion exchange efficiency.

Notes When Using and Preserving Sulfuric Acid

Notes When Using Sulfuric Acid

  • Avoid direct contact of sulfuric acid with skin, eyes or inhalation of acid vapors, especially in confined spaces.
  • Always slowly pour acid into water (do not do the opposite) to avoid a strong exothermic reaction causing splashing.
  • Use full protective equipment such as glasses, gloves, boots and chemical resistant clothing.

Notes When Preserving Sulfuric Acid

  • Do not store acid in corrosive materials such as aluminum, tin, zinc; prioritize using specialized composite, HDPE, FRP tanks.
  • Store in a cool, dry area, away from heat sources and flammable substances, with clear warning signs.
  • Keep containers tightly closed and fully labeled with information on concentration, hazardous properties and emergency response instructions.

FAQ – Frequently Asked Questions About Sulfuric Acid H₂SO₄

  1. 1. What is sulfuric acid and why is it considered a fundamental chemical?Sulfuric acid (sulfuric acid, H₂SO₄) is a strong, highly corrosive, hygroscopic inorganic acid that is widely used in fertilizer production, metallurgy, chemicals, water treatment, and energy.
    H₂SO₄ consumption is often used as an indicator of a country's level of industrial development, as it occurs in most basic chemical production chains.
  2. 2. Sulfuric acid is most widely used in which industry?The industry that uses sulfuric acid the most is fertilizer production, especially phosphate fertilizers (superphosphate), ammonium sulfate and NPK fertilizer lines.
    In addition, H₂SO₄ is also widely used in metallurgy, battery production, basic chemicals and wastewater treatment.
  3. 3. What should be noted when diluting sulfuric acid to ensure safety?The important principle is always slowly pour acid into water, pour and stir well, absolutely do not pour water into acid.
    Doing the opposite may cause the water to boil locally, causing hot solution to splash, which is very dangerous for the operator.
  4. 4. Is sulfuric acid harmful to the environment?If H₂SO₄ is discharged uncontrolled, the acid can sharply reduce water pH, harm aquatic life, affect soil and corrode structures.
    Therefore, all wastewater containing H₂SO₄ must be neutralized and properly treated before being discharged into the environment.
